肾小球滤过率与肌酐清除率的差值鉴别急性和慢性肾衰

摘    要:目的探讨用放射性核素肾动态显像测的肾小球滤过率(GFR)与肌酐清除率(Ccr)的差值能否鉴剐急性肾衰和慢性肾衰。方法主要通过肾脏病理区分急性肾衰和慢性肾衰。共研究63例患者,59例患者行肾活检检查,4例未行肾活检患者为临床上典型的慢性肾衰病人。采用自身对照的研究方法,用^99mTc-DTPA肾动态显像测定急性肾衰33例和慢性肾衰30例的GFR,其中急性肾衰病因为急性肾小管坏死和急性小管间质性肾炎15例、狼疮性肾炎1例、急进性肾炎17例;慢性肾衰病因为慢性肾炎25例,慢性间质性肾炎1例,高血压肾病2例,糖尿病肾病2例。同时也用血肌酐估算患者的肌酐清除率,比较急、慢性肾衰这两个数差值的变异。结果急性肾衰组和慢性肾衰组患者的血清肌酐(Scr)和GFR均无明显的差异,但其自身GFR(18.8±13.97ml/min)与Ccr(10.78±12.46ml/min)的差值有显著性差异(P〈0.05)。进一步把急性肾衰分为小管性急性肾衰和小球性急性肾衰,小管性急性肾衰组与小球性急性肾衰和慢性肾衰的Scr和GFR间差异也不大(P〉0.05),不过小管性急性肾衰的GFR—Ccr明显高于小球性急性肾衰(P〈0.001)和慢性肾衰(P〈0.05),数值分别为(25.09±13.46)ml/min,(13.56±12.41)ml/min,(10.78±12.46)ml/min,而在小球性急性肾衰与慢性肾衰间这个差值无显著意K(P〉0.05)。结论放射性核素肾动态显像可用于小管性急性肾衰与小球性急性肾衰及慢性肾衰的鉴别,尤其是其自身的GFR与Ccr的差值大于25ml/min,多为小管性急性肾衰。

Abstract:Objective To investigate the clinical significance of differences of glomerular filtration rate (GFR) and creatine clearance rate (Ccr)in differential diagnosis of patients with acute renal failure (ARF)and chronic renal failure (CRF). Methods First,63 Patients in Department of Nephrology,Hainan Province People's Hospital,were enrolled in present study and 33 definitely diagnosised as ARF cases and 30 CRF cases,59 patients were undergone renal-biopsy and the other 4 patients with CRF were not.
